Build #1
Fishman + Flame Fruit
Difficulty: Easy
Role: Fast Leveling
Equipment
| Slot | Item |
|---|---|
| Race | Fishman |
| Fruit | Flame |
| Sword | Any starter sword |
| Accessories | Defense gear |
Stat Allocation
| Stat | % |
|---|---|
| Fruit | 55 |
| Defense | 25 |
| Melee | 10 |
| Sword | 10 |
| Gun | 0 |
Rotation
Flame AoE → M1 → Move → Repeat
Strengths
- Strong AoE for early farming
- Very simple gameplay
- Easy to obtain
- Good leveling speed in early zones
Weaknesses
- Falls off mid-game
- Limited scaling later
Note
This is a temporary leveling build.
Use it to farm quickly, then switch to Light or a stronger setup.
Build #2
Qin Shi Melee (No Fruit)
Difficulty: Easy
Role: Stable Progression
Equipment
| Slot | Item |
|---|---|
| Race | Fishman |
| Fruit | None |
| Sword | Starter → upgrade |
| Accessories | Any |
Stat Allocation
| Stat | % |
|---|---|
| Fruit | 0 |
| Defense | 30 |
| Melee | 50 |
| Sword | 20 |
| Gun | 0 |
Rotation
Skills → M1 → reposition → repeat
Strengths
- No RNG required
- Consistent damage in all areas
- Easy to start early
- Good transition into late-game melee builds
Weaknesses
- Slower than fruit builds early
- Weak ranged options
Note
Qin Shi is a bridge melee build.
Later progression usually goes:
- Mid game → Blessed Maiden
- Endgame → Anos / Gilgamesh :contentReference[oaicite:4]4
Build #3
Light Fruit Rush (If Affordable)
Difficulty: Medium
Role: AoE Speed Farming
Equipment
| Slot | Item |
|---|---|
| Race | Fishman |
| Fruit | Light |
| Sword | None |
| Accessories | Fruit damage gear |
Stat Allocation
| Stat | % |
|---|---|
| Fruit | 75 |
| Defense | 20 |
| Melee | 5 |
| Sword | 0 |
| Gun | 0 |
Rotation
Light AoE → Fly → Next group → Repeat
Strengths
- Best fruit in the game (damage + mobility) :contentReference[oaicite:5]5
- Flight massively improves farming efficiency
- Strong at all stages of the game
- High AoE clear speed
Weaknesses
- Expensive early
- Requires positioning
- Low survivability without defense
Note
If you can afford Light early, this is the best long-term choice.
Unlike Flame, it does not fall off later.
